God has limited Himself in His dealings on earth as we read in Acts 9:1-16. But you may ask, who else could He use?

God could have chosen angels to proclaim the gospel.In one sense using His own heavenly host would have been so much easier.

No committees, fundraising or prayer meetings to discern the will of God. The  message would have been perfect and the results amazing.

But God chose to use ordinary people, who were willing to give themselves into His service. The searching cry of God in Isaiah 6:8 “Whom shall I send and who will go for us?” is still the same today.

Saul opened his heart and ears to listen to God as he was personally called by God into His service. Would you be surprised, shocked or frightened if God called you?

Are yourhearts and ears open to listen and will you go where He leads you? The gospel still needs to be proclaimed and God needs all of us to be his messengers in the world.
